Quapaw jacket, sun and moon, ceremony, battle scene. Also called the 'three villages cape'. Arkansas, USA. Ca. 1740. Bison (?) hide painted, 192 x 265 x 3 cm; 1912 g. Inv. 71.1934.33.7D. Photo: Claude Germain.
Location
Musée du Quai Branly - Jacques Chirac/Paris/France
